您好,欢迎访问上海聚搜信息技术有限公司官方网站!
24小时咨询热线:4008-020-360

阿里云国际站:angularjs自定义过滤器demo示例

时间:2025-06-19 03:29:02 点击:

AngularJS 自定义过滤器 Demo 示例:结合阿里云国际站代理商优势

在现代的Web开发中,数据的处理和展示是非常重要的部分。而AngularJS作为一个功能强大的框架,为我们提供了众多便捷的工具,其中过滤器是一项非常实用的功能。通过自定义过滤器,我们可以根据业务需求对数据进行动态处理和呈现。

本文以AngularJS自定义过滤器的Demo示例为主线,同时结合阿里云国际站的使用体验与阿里云代理商的服务优势,来分享如何优化开发流程,实现高效开发。

一、AngularJS 自定义过滤器概述

过滤器(Filter)是在AngularJS中用于对数据进行格式化或处理的一种方式。内置的过滤器如 uppercaselowercasecurrency 等已经能满足很多常见的需求。但对于复杂的场景,创建自定义过滤器是一个非常灵活的解决方案。

在自定义过滤器中,我们可以接收输入数据、处理逻辑并返回格式化后的结果,使数据更符合我们的业务需求。

二、AngularJS 自定义过滤器 Demo 示例

以下是一个简单的示例代码,展示如何创建一个自定义过滤器,用于对列表中的名称附加前缀“阿里云-”:

        
            // 定义模块和过滤器
            var app = angular.module('myApp', []);
            
            app.filter('addPrefix', function() {
                return function(input) {
                    if (!input) {
                        return '阿里云-未知名称';
                    }
                    return '阿里云-' + input;
                };
            });
            
            // 控制器示例
            app.controller('myCtrl', function($scope) {
                $scope.names = ['李华', '张伟', '王静'];
            });
        
    

配套的HTML代码:

        
            <div ng-app="myApp" ng-controller="myCtrl">
                <ul>
                    <li ng-repeat="name in names">
                        {{ name | addPrefix }}
                    </li>
                </ul>
            </div>
        
    

上述代码中定义了一个名为 addPrefix 的过滤器,可以给数据添加一个固定的前缀。在展示列表时,通过管道符号(|)将过滤器应用于数据,并生成具有前缀的新字符串。

三、结合阿里云国际站的技术优势

在开发过程中,选择好的云服务平台是至关重要的。阿里云国际站作为全球领先的云计算服务提供商,具备以下多项优势:

  • 全球覆盖:阿里云的云数据中心分布于全球多个国家和地区,可以为开发者提供稳定、低延迟的访问体验。
  • 弹性扩展:阿里云国际站支持灵活的资源配置,开发者可以根据业务需求随时调整云服务器、存储容量等资源。
  • 安全保障:阿里云有领先的安全技术,为用户提供DDoS防护、数据加密等全面的安全解决方案,确保应用和数据的安全性。
  • 丰富的生态系统:阿里云国际站支持多种编程语言和框架,开发者可以方便地部署AngularJS应用到云端环境。

四、阿里云代理商的价值与服务

除了直接使用阿里云国际站的服务,通过阿里云代理商也可以获得额外的支持和服务。有实力的代理商可以帮助客户更好地理解和使用阿里云产品,同时提供定制化解决方案。

  • 专业咨询服务:阿里云代理商通常会有技术专家团队,可根据客户需求提供量身定制的云解决方案。
  • 优惠政策:部分代理商可以为客户申请更具竞争力的价格优惠,让项目成本更低。
  • 本地化支持:代理商提供本地语言支持和售后服务,帮助客户快速解决问题。
  • 增值服务:代理商可能提供培训、迁移指导以及运营维护服务,让客户专注于核心业务,无需担心技术难题。

五、总结

在实际开发中,利用AngularJS自定义过滤器可以实现灵活的数据处理和展示。而结合阿里云国际站的技术优势与阿里云代理商的增值服务,开发者不仅可以享受到全球领先的云产品,还能获得周到的技术支持和优惠政策。在选择合作伙伴方面,通过阿里云代理商可以进一步提升服务质量并优化成本,这使得项目的开发和上线变得更加轻松。

总之,AngularJS和阿里云的结合为开发者提供了高效的开发体验,而阿里云代理商则通过专业的服务让开发者安心无忧。希望本文关于AngularJS自定义过滤器的示例,对大家有所启发,同时也感受到阿里云及其生态系统的强大力量!

收缩
  • 电话咨询

  • 4008-020-360
微信咨询 获取代理价(更低折扣)
更低报价 更低折扣 代金券申请
咨询热线: 15026612550